Why Eyebrow-Threading Remains a Client Favorite
Eyebrow-threading has stood the test of time for good reason. Unlike waxing or tweezing, threading uses a twisted cotton thread to grasp and remove hair at the follicle level. This method offers several distinct advantages that keep clients coming back.
Precision and control. Threading allows for incredibly precise shaping. The aesthetician can remove individual hairs or small groups, creating sharp, defined arches that are difficult to achieve with other methods. This level of control is especially important for clients with sensitive skin or those who want a very specific brow shape.
Gentle on skin. Because threading does not involve hot wax or chemicals, it is far less likely to cause irritation, redness, or allergic reactions. This makes it ideal for clients with conditions like rosacea, eczema, or simply sensitive skin. The thread only contacts the hair, not the skin surface, reducing the risk of burns or abrasions.
Long-lasting results. Threading removes hair from the root, which means regrowth is slower compared to shaving or depilatory creams. Clients typically enjoy smooth, well-defined brows for two to four weeks, depending on their natural hair growth cycle. This longevity is a major selling point for busy individuals who value time-saving solutions.
Cost-effective and quick. A typical eyebrow-threading session takes only ten to fifteen minutes, making it an easy add-on service or a standalone appointment. The low cost relative to other aesthetic treatments also makes it accessible to a wide range of clients, encouraging repeat visits.

Practical Comparison: Eyebrow-Threading vs. Other Brow Services
To help clients make informed decisions, it is useful to understand how eyebrow-threading compares to other popular brow services. The table below outlines key differences.

| Service | Method | Duration | Results Last | Best For | Skin Sensitivity |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Eyebrow-Threading | Twisted cotton thread | 10-15 minutes | 2-4 weeks | Precise shaping, sensitive skin | Low irritation |
| Waxing | Hot or cold wax | 10-15 minutes | 2-4 weeks | Larger areas, quick removal | Moderate irritation possible |
| Tweezing | Manual plucking | 15-30 minutes | 1-3 weeks | Maintenance, stray hairs | Low irritation |
| Sugaring | Natural sugar paste | 15-20 minutes | 2-4 weeks | Sensitive skin, eco-conscious | Low irritation |
| Brow Lamination | Chemical setting | 30-45 minutes | 4-6 weeks | Fuller, brushed-up look | Moderate irritation possible |
